So can a dotfile, or any other kind of storage. There's really nothing inherently bad about the registry. Its reputation as a place to hide things in is equal parts selection bias, users' lack of technical understanding, and the marketing of "registry cleaner" apps.
Fun fact: The Windows executable format is originally based on an old Unix executable format.
In New Vegas, completing Arcade Gannon's companion sidequest gives you a suit of Enclave advanced power armor, and a squad of Enclave troops with a vertibird will back you up at Hoover Dam. It's virtually impossible to trigger this quest by accident.
